A highly reliable approach for lasting protection in the vicinity is through chemical barriers. This approach involves the application of a specialized liquid termiticide to the soil surrounding the entire structure boundary. Advanced non-repellent chemicals are extremely efficient as they go undiscovered by termites. Instead of avoiding them, the bugs go through the cured location and transport the compound back to the primary nest. This sets off the transfer result, eventually eliminating the queen and the rest of the nest. During the building and construction of brand-new homes or significant restorations, reticulation systems are regularly suggested as a modern service. These systems involve a series of punctured pipelines that are put underground throughout the structure procedure. When the chemical barrier needs to be renewed, a specialist can easily inject the liquid through particular filler points in the system. This approach ensures the uniform spread of the protective compound without needing substantial excavation or drilling into expensive surfaces like pavers and concrete paths. For environmentally sensitive locations or homes where setting up soil barriers is challenging, keeping an eye on and baiting stations provide an alternative option. These stations, tactically placed throughout the area, lure termites with wood inserts. Technicians routinely examine these stations for any termite activity. Upon identifying termites, the timber is switched with a powerful bait containing an insect development regulator. The foraging termites consume the bait and distribute it within their colony, disrupting their molting procedure and triggering the nest to collapse entirely. This approach is precise, requiring only a minimal amount of active ingredient compared to standard soil treatments.
A detailed defence approach also relies heavily on the incorporation of physical obstacles. Generally integrated into the building phase, these challenges, such as layers of stainless steel mesh or crushed stone, effectively prevent termite seepage. Although they don't remove the pests, they reroute them to exposed locations where their mud tubes emerge throughout routine checks. Particularly in locations with sloping land or subfloor spaces, it's essential to protect the integrity of these physical obstacles. If compromised, such as when a garden bed is erected against a wall, these barriers can create an uncontrolled pathway for pests to infiltrate the structure undetected.

To reduce the risk of problem, homeowners need to keep a tidy lawn by eliminating mess, such as woodpiles, fire wood, and cardboard boxes that enter into contact with the soil. Enhancing drainage around the structure of the home is likewise important, as excess moisture can draw termites to the location. Simple steps like repairing dripping faucets and redirecting warm water system overflow pipelines away from your house can make a substantial distinction. By keeping the residential or commercial property dry and without mess, house owners can make their residence less prone to termite colonization, reducing the possibility of a problem.
